Skate Free Charlie: A Mother's Love and a Son's Legacy
Description
In this heartfelt episode of 'Leveling Up with Lindsay,' Lindsay sits down with Erika Boike, a mother who has turned her unimaginable grief into a mission to honor her late son, Charlie. After losing Charlie in a tragic car accident at the age of 17, Erika and her family have dedicated themselves to keeping his spirit alive through their initiative, 'Skate Free Charlie' and the 'Zamboni Spirit Ride.' Erika shares her journey through loss, the strength she finds in her community, and the powerful ways in which Charlie's legacy continues to inspire joy, kindness, and community connection.
